It turned out the su binary was owned by my unprivileged user. How do i set or change the root password for my ec2 linux instance. For system security reasons, root access to synology nas is limited. It is very important for a linux user to understand these two to increase security and prevent unexpected things that a user may have to go. The first step to enabling root login over ssh is to enable the root account.
This keeps users from making mistakes or accidentally exposing the system to vulnerabilities. We will explain how to reset or recover forgottent mysql or mariadb root password in linux. However, i dont like the idea of adding user martin to group wheel. I compiled shadow in the course of building linux from scratch 8.
Search for terminal in mac launchpad or linux application. Enter the password of the account you used to sign in again. Dsm is running on a custom linux version developed by synology. If you would like to use root instead here are the instructions to do so. To check if a user is in the administrators group, go to control paneluser, doubleclick on the users name and go to user groups. Using ssh key authentification on a synology nas for. Network video recorder deep learning nvr visualstation device license pack.
Since it runs linux, you can install programs for linux compiled for the arm architecture. For the money, the zee s2 is great since it comes with a zwave controller builtin.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. I like this because it means the user needs two passwords in order to gain root access, both a limited users password and the. Last night my synology upgraded to a new version and now my root password when logging in to ssh no longer works. Some live linux distributions are created without a root password by default the root account is inactive. The scripts must be run as root, so you need to use a synology account which user is in administrators group. In dsm 5 and earlier i could simply log in as user root right from the start but this is.
If you want to change user or root password of synology nas you need to use. If you want to change the admin or some user password from the settings of synology dsm. How to change root password in ubuntu linux nixcraft. We would like to show you a description here but the site wont allow us. How to use root in synology dsm amigos technical notes. In an act of despair, i changed joeusers uid to 0 on etcpasswd, but also didnt work, so it doesnt seem to be something permission related. Now, i will be the first to admit that i have no linux skills to speak of. How to reset mysql or mariadb root password in linux. Using rsync to backup an ubuntu server to synology nas. In any linux, as also in any ubuntu version, there is a superuser named root, the windows equivalent of user in the administrators group. Sometimes you just want root access because its your box synology simply has not set a password for account root actually they locked it out using a for password hash. In the case a regular user cant remember hisher password, a superuser can reset the password of a regular user right from the terminal. Enter the new strong password two times and then click on the submit to change the root or default password of the synology nas.
How to enable root ssh login on linux addictivetips. Most basic linux user accounts run with limited privileges. Luckily i had found some and i summarized the one works on mine unit as below. But if youre reading this a few days or years from now, too bad. Jan 16, 2019 a normal user may only change the password for hisher own account, the super user or root may change the password for any account. Removing the mysql root password benjamin morel medium. You cant find the root password, if you could it would break the security model. Now, this is good to know as cifs repositories do not have. Synology dsm root password for ssh primal cortexs weblog. The administrator of a group may change the password for the group. Oct 11, 2016 i loaded linux station with ubuntu 16.
That behaviour is by design on linux based operating systems. News, discussion, and community support for synology devices. If you forget the password or need to reset it for example, when a database administrator changes roles or is laid off. Nov 27, 2014 the default user is root, so if you just enter su at a command line it assumes you want to be root. Experience synology s most acclaimed dsm operating system for free today. In linux, regular users and superusers are allowed to access services via password authentication.
How to install compiled programs on a synology nas. Get unlimited access to the best stories on medium and support writers while youre at it. If so is installing the key as usual into the home folder of root. Tested on linux mint 17 qiana author shekin reading 3 min published by november 16. Whats the default root users password inside a docker container. How to login to dsm with root permission via sshtelnet synology. However, what if the superuser or root user loses hisher password. How to change root password of mysql or mariadb in linux. Grant a user root permissions, or assume root user permissions by running the sudo su command. Attend a workshop and get technical training, best practices, and more. How to reset synology nas password to factory settings h2s. My steps for a working ssh connection raspberry pi to synology.
The only differences between building your own nas with a good server distro like debian stable and running a commercial synology box are. In linux, root privileges or root access refers to a user account that has full access to all files, applications, and system functions. By default, root is not allowed to connect, you need to connect with another user and use sudo su type the password of the user you are connected with, not the root password. Its optimized for running on a nas server with all of the features you often need in a nas device. How to recover a lost or forgotten linux root password depends on how well the system was protected originally. An introduction today were going to discuss sudo and su, the very important and mostly used commands in linux. Using ssh key authentification on a synology nas for remote. Also a su joeuser as root works fine, so the bash binary itself is working fine. Ubuntu synology problem with permissions linux forum. Hi, when using ssh i can get root access by typing in sudo su does anybody know if i can use ssh keys here, too using e. Suchen sie in mac launchpad oder linux anwendung nach terminal. Should i always use sudo or get the default root password, if any. Seems that bash is doing some extra checking that sshd didnt like, and blocking the connections for non root users. Mar 28, 2016 to do this at the ssh login, you would simply use the user name root instead of admin, or another user.
If your synology is in dsm6 and youre logged with a user part of administrator group, you can do. As a result, you can not login using root user or use a command such as su. However, even nonadministrators can use the rsync service. To get a temporary root password to complete a task, follow these steps. I dont want to give martin any more privileges than to be able to switch to martintest. To do this at the ssh login, you would simply use the user name root instead of admin, or another user. As now, you should be able to ssh using the root account and apply changes as needed. I tried with su to switch to root, but i dont know its password. Ubuntu linux root password find default root user password. This is where you activate and set the root password. If you need to change it for example, when a database administrator changes roles or. I need to allow user martin to switch to user martintest without password. How to reset synology nas password to factory settings.
How can i change root password in ubuntu linux server using the bash shell over ssh based session. Setting a root password enables us to access some essential tools such as the synaptic installer. Feb 27, 2020 the permissions shown suggest so but when nfs mounting as root sometimes strange things happen. By default, the username will appear, admin, you can change that too. I even tried to use the known password for the root user to logon, but that also failed. However you can enable the root account and set a password for it. Is there a default root password when linux station is installed. You do need to make sure that your user account is an admin account. Im using a docker image which was built using the user command to use a non root user called dev. Login as root after switching to root, use synouser setpw root new password for. Before i explain how to change the default password, its good to know about root superuser and sudo user in linux.
Jun 14, 2018 by default, root is not allowed to connect, you need to connect with another user and use sudo su type the password of the user you are connected with, not the root password. You have to first ssh as admin then use sudo su to root. There are already some lines in that file which can be uncommented. Open putty and fill in the ipaddress of your synology nas and click open. If you just need to change root s password, and you are already logged in as root, just type passwd at a shell prompt to reset it. The permissions shown suggest so but when nfs mounting as root sometimes strange things happen. This is particularly true with debian based distributions like ubuntu. It runs the exact same stuff as any other distro, including the kernel and all services and the filesystem. So it turns out that its possible to use a synology nas as a native linux repository within veeam. Lost linux root password recovery multiple ways to reset. Therefore, you cannot log in as root or use su command to become a superuser. Example of how to reboot a synology with a ssh rule i was looking for a solution to restart my always running synology nas like the system or pimatic sudo reboot rule. If you want to change user or root password of synology nas you need to use synouser command instead of passwd as below example. Create a new user that belongs to the admins group.
Only members of the administrators group are allowed to connect by ssh. By default root account is locked under ubuntu linux. For more information see rootsudo community ubuntu documentation. Issue command sudo su password for kali user account issue command passwd root. Synology dsm cant log as root but works with admin super user. For many linux distributions ubuntu and others like it, root isnt active, for security. How to become root or any other user using the linux command line. If you want to change user or root password of synology nas you need to use synouser command instead of passwd. Cant log in via ssh to any accounts using binbash shell on synology nas. Cant log in via ssh to any accounts using binbash shell. It says to login to the admin account, and then use synouser setpw root and then the password to set the new password. How to change synology nas root password ssh the synology nas or network attached storage is base on linux but it doesnt have a passwd command as usually linux system to change synology nas user or root password.
In dsm 5 and earlier i could simply log in as user root right from the start but this is no longer possible. Inside a container, im dev, but i want to edit the etchosts file. Logging in is easyyou just enable the ssh servicebut if you want to become root once youre logged in, you cant. Im trying the su command, but im asked to enter the root password. Usually, the synology nas would just be configured as a cifs smb target or better yet accessed via iscsi attached to a managed server. Xpenology creates the possibility to run the synology dsm on any x86 device like any pc or selfbuilt nas. How to reset mariadb root password in linux systems. How to reset the root password in linux make tech easier. This make life a little bit easier since always typing in my. Enter command sudo su and providing admin password.
Centralize data storage and backup, streamline file collaboration, optimize video management, and secure network deployment to facilitate data management. Also, by default root does not have a password which prevents you from logging in as root. Jan 11, 2015 how to use sudo and su commands in linux. The synology nas or network attached storage is base on linux but it doesnt have a passwd command as usually linux system to change synology nas user or root password. Set or change the root password for an ec2 linux instance. Root password inside a docker container stack overflow. In the end, i really dont want to spend all this money getting a nas only to find that i cant use it like i want to. But theres something really wrong, and i cant figure out what it is. Example of how to reboot a synology with a ssh rule. The root user can do anything and everything, and thus doing daily work as the superuser can be dangerous.
For the most part, not using the root account is fine, and sudo can do the job. When you change the user with su you will be prompted for the password for the account you are trying to switch to. However, it says to change the password for root, and then login as root. This was something that could be done when i had a fully controllable dedicated server, but since changing to the synology nas, it has eluded me. If you ran the command with sudo then you will be asked for the sudo password but if you ran the command just as su then you will need to enter the root. By default, the root user account password is locked in ubuntu linux for security reasons.
Synology nas resetting to factory defaults reset admin password only and factory reset. Kozponti adattarolas es biztonsagi mentes, a fajlokon vegzett kozos munka egyszerusitese, a videokezeles optimalizalasa, biztonsagos halozati rendszerek es egyszerubb adatkezeles. Basically synology hardcoded a modified login binary within the firmware that accepts an obfuscated password for root, which depends on the current. I bought a synology diskstation ds211j and like many nas on the market, it is a small computer powered by an arm processor and runs the linux operating system. How synology simplified unescos global it infrastructure. I have already tested and i can login to other ssh accounts and i can also login to the synology admin page using same password that i am using for root. Lately i been searching over internet for guide to get access to my synology nas root privelage.
205 860 119 1520 1011 469 1414 45 1327 1309 1423 1508 1301 692 1055 1590 809 1517 1651 87 620 425 1374 827 918 628 1521 470 1470 15 1409 280 855 456 1455 227 164 1497